Understanding Unpasteurised Cheese
Unpasteurised cheese, also known as raw milk cheese, is made from milk that has not been pasteurised. Pasteurisation is a process that involves heating the milk to a high temperature for a short period to kill off bacteria and extend its shelf life. Unpasteurised cheese retains the natural bacteria found in the milk, which can contribute to its unique flavor and texture. The production of unpasteurised cheese is often associated with traditional and artisanal methods, appealing to those who value authenticity and the preservation of cultural heritage.

Health Risks Associated with Unpasteurised Cheese
While unpasteurised cheese offers a unique culinary experience, it also poses potential health risks due to the presence of harmful bacteria like E. coli, Listeria, and Salmonella. These pathogens can cause severe illnesses, particularly in vulnerable populations such as the elderly, pregnant women, and individuals with compromised immune systems. The risk of contamination is higher in unpasteurised cheese because the pasteurisation process, which would normally kill these bacteria, is omitted.
Pathogens of Concern
Among the pathogens that can be present in unpasteurised cheese, Listeria monocytogenes is of particular concern. Listeria can cause listeriosis, a serious infection that can lead to severe illness and even death in high-risk individuals. E. coli and Salmonella are also significant risks, as they can cause a range of symptoms from mild gastrointestinal distress to life-threatening conditions.
Regulations and Safety Measures
To mitigate the risks associated with unpasteurised cheese, many countries have implemented regulations and safety measures. For example, in the United States, the US FDA requires that unpasteurised cheese be aged for at least 60 days at a temperature not less than 35°F (2°C). This aging process is believed to reduce the risk of pathogen survival. Additionally, dairy farms and cheesemakers must adhere to strict hygiene and testing protocols to ensure the quality and safety of their products.

What are the potential health risks associated with eating unpasteurised cheese?
Eating unpasteurised cheese can pose potential health risks, particularly for certain groups of people. The main concern is the risk of contracting foodborne illnesses, such as listeriosis, salmonellosis, and brucellosis, which can be caused by the presence of bacteria like Listeria, Salmonella, and Brucella in the cheese. These bacteria can be especially harmful to vulnerable populations, including the elderly, pregnant women, young children, and people with weakened immune systems. If infected, individuals may experience symptoms such as fever, headache, and abdominal pain, which can range from mild to severe.
It is essential to note that the risk of contracting a foodborne illness from unpasteurised cheese is relatively low, and many types of unpasteurised cheese are considered safe to eat. However, it is crucial to take precautions and choose unpasteurised cheese from reputable sources, such as licensed dairy farms or artisanal cheese makers, which follow proper handling and production procedures. Furthermore, individuals who are at high risk of infection should consider avoiding unpasteurised cheese altogether or opting for pasteurised alternatives to minimize their risk of exposure. By being informed and taking necessary precautions, consumers can enjoy unpasteurised cheese while minimizing the potential health risks.

Can I eat unpasteurised cheese if I am pregnant or have a weakened immune system?
It is generally recommended that pregnant women and individuals with weakened immune systems avoid eating unpasteurised cheese due to the potential risk of foodborne illness. Unpasteurised cheese can contain bacteria like Listeria, Salmonella, and Brucella, which can be particularly harmful to vulnerable populations. Pregnant women are at increased risk of listeriosis, a type of foodborne illness caused by Listeria, which can lead to serious health complications, including miscarriage, stillbirth, and birth defects. Similarly, individuals with weakened immune systems, such as those with HIV/AIDS or undergoing chemotherapy, may be more susceptible to foodborne illness and should take extra precautions to avoid unpasteurised cheese.
However, it is essential to note that not all unpasteurised cheeses are created equal, and some may be safer to eat than others. Hard, aged cheeses like cheddar, Swiss, and Parmesan are generally considered safer than softer, younger cheeses like brie, feta, and goat cheese. If you are pregnant or have a weakened immune system and still want to enjoy unpasteurised cheese, consider opting for pasteurised alternatives or choosing cheeses that have been aged for a longer period, which can help to reduce the presence of bacteria and other microorganisms. It is also crucial to consult with a healthcare professional or registered dietitian for personalized advice on safe food choices during pregnancy or when experiencing immune system weakness.
